Sirigu joins the Viola. Gollini loan ended
ACF Fiorentina is pleased to announce that Salvatore Sirigu is now a Fiorentina player. The 36-year-old has been signed on a permanent deal from SSC Napoli.
Born in Nuoro, Sardinia on 12 January 1987, the well-travelled goalkeeper has plied his trade for Palermo, Paris Saint-Germain, Sevilla, Osasuna, Torino and Genoa, among other clubs.
Sirigu has 28 Italy caps to his name and was a member of the Azzurri squad that won Euro 2020.
Meanwhile Pierluigi Gollini has returned to Atalanta after his loan was terminated.
